Polish Pottery originated in the historic town of Boleslawiec, Poland in the early 1800's.  Using locally sourced clay, each piece is molded into the desired shape, hand painted or hand stamped, glazed then fired to over 2250 degrees Fahrenheit.  The result of this process is stoneware that is not only beautiful, but functional enough for every day use.
